Description

The Department of Veterans Affairs is seeking proposals from qualified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Businesses (SDVOSB) for the provision and installation of specialized histology slide and cassette printing systems at the Central Arkansas Veterans Healthcare System in Little Rock, Arkansas. The objective of this procurement is to enhance the electronic tracking and storage of pathology specimens, thereby reducing errors associated with manual filing and improving overall efficiency in the Histology Laboratory. The selected contractor will be responsible for delivering, setting up, and testing the equipment, which includes a slide printer and a cassette printer that must meet specific technical requirements, along with providing onsite training and technical support. The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) has released a presolicitation notice for a contract concerning the provision and installation of specialized histology slide and cassette printing systems at the Central Arkansas Veterans Healthcare System. The project aims to improve electronic tracking and storage of pathology specimens while minimizing errors associated with manual filing. Bids are sought from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Businesses (SDVOSB), with a scheduled response deadline of April 15, 2025. The contractor is responsible for delivering, setting up, and testing the equipment, which includes a slide printer and a cassette printer, both of which must meet specified technical requirements. Key features include rapid printing capabilities, automated labeling, and compatibility with existing VA systems. The vendor will also provide onsite training, technical support, and an annual service contract. Interested parties must submit company information, including their business type and past experiences, in response to this notice. This presolicitation serves as a market research tool and does not constitute a formal solicitation.
